#996dae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#996dae is composed of 60% red, 42.7%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.1%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 280.6 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 55.5%. #996dae color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#33005d.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#996dae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#996dae has RGB values of R:153, G:109,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 10055086.

Shades and Tints of #996dae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050305 is the darkest color, while #faf8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#996dae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908794 is the less saturated color, while #b51efd is the most saturated one.
